LAWN TENNIS
WANGANUI EAST AND RATA HOME TEAM’S EASY WIN. At the week-end Wanganui East Tennis Club played a friendly match with Rata at the Wanganui East courts. Wanganui East had a fairly easy win. The courts were very fast and had plenty of grass. Mr. A. Walker, on behalf of the Wanganui East Club, welcomed the matches with the country had for a visitors. The home - and - away number of years been one of the most enjoyable features of the Wanganui East Club’s activities, he said, and the members looked forward to them more so than the Association interclub matches. Mr. Alton Rhodes replied for the Rata Club and thanked the Wanganui East Club for the invitation to play at their courts. He also stressed the point that although they were defeated, that was not everything, because they all enjoyed the day. He paid a compliment to the club, on the beautiful grounds and the condition of the courts, and he called for three cheers for the ladies who provided the afternoon tea. An enjoyable afternoon tea was served by the Wanganui East Women’s committee under the supevision of Miss Ede.
